Hi, everyone.
I downloaded Knoppix and created a boot CD. When I boot from the CD, I get a "root:" prompt. When I press <Enter> at that point, Knoppix displays several messages on screen, then stops with the error:
insmod:insmod:insmod/lib/modules/2.2.24-xfs/kernel/drivers/input/input.0 failed
insmod:insmod:insmod usbkbd failed
I have a Dell dimension 8200 with a Dell/Logitech Cordless iTouch Keyboard (USB), M/N Y-RB6.
Am I supposed to enter something other than <Enter> at the prompt? If not, how can I get Knoppix to recognize my keyboard?
Thanks.
The easy solution is to use a USB > PS2 adapter on your keyboard. They're usually green and come with any USB mouse.
